What are the system requirements for The Silver Case on PC?
To run The Silver Case on your PC, you need at least a SSE2 instruction set support / greater processor and a DX9 (shader model 3.0) / greater graphics card. For the best experience, a SSE2 instruction set support / greater CPU and DX9 (shader model 3.0) / greater GPU are recommended. The game also requires a minimum of 4 GB RAM RAM, 7 GB available space of disk space, — as your operating system, and DirectX 9.0.
